Backflow service involves inspecting, testing, and repairing backflow prevention devices to ensure that drinking water supplies remain safe and uncontaminated. These devices are installed in plumbing systems to prevent potentially polluted water from flowing back into the clean water supply. Regular testing and maintenance of backflow preventers are essential to identify any issues early and ensure they function correctly, especially in areas with complex plumbing systems or where water quality is a concern.

This service helps address problems such as device malfunctions, leaks, or blockages that could compromise water safety. Over time, backflow preventers can become damaged or worn out, which may lead to backflow incidents. Such incidents can introduce contaminants into the potable water supply, posing health risks and violating local health regulations. Routine inspections and repairs help prevent these issues and maintain compliance with local plumbing codes.

Properties that typically utilize backflow services include commercial buildings, industrial facilities, and multi-unit residential complexes. These properties often have complex plumbing systems with fire suppression systems, irrigation, or other water uses that increase the risk of backflow. Additionally, properties located near agricultural runoff, wastewater treatment facilities, or areas with potential contamination sources may require regular backflow testing and maintenance to safeguard public health and ensure water quality.

Backflow Testing - The cost typically ranges from $150 to $300 for standard backflow testing services. Prices may vary based on the complexity of the system and location. Local pros can provide detailed estimates tailored to specific needs.

Backflow Repair - Repair costs generally fall between $200 and $1,000, depending on the extent of the issue and parts required. Additional charges may apply for emergency or after-hours services. Contact local service providers for precise quotes.

Backflow Prevention Device Installation - Installing a new backflow prevention device can cost from $500 to $2,000, influenced by device type and system size. Some projects may include additional plumbing or site preparation expenses. Local pros can offer cost estimates based on specific installation requirements.

Backflow Device Replacement - Replacing an existing device typically costs $600 to $2,500, depending on device specifications and accessibility. Prices can vary based on the complexity of removal and installation. Reach out to local contractors for accurate pricing details.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is backflow prevention service? Backflow prevention service involves inspecting and maintaining devices that pr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ply.

Why is backflow testing important? Regular testing ensures that backflow prevention devices are functioning properly to protect drinking water quality.

How often should backflow devices be serviced? It is typically recommended to have backflow devices inspected and tested annually by a professional service provider.

What signs indicate a backflow issue? Signs may include unusual water pressure, discoloration, or odors in the water supply, which should be checked by a professional.
